One of the most accessible entry points is through staking. Imagine owning a share of a company and receiving dividends for your investment; staking is the crypto equivalent. By holding certain cryptocurrencies, you can “stake” them to support the network’s operations – validating transactions and securing the blockchain. In return, you are rewarded with more of the same cryptocurrency, effectively earning a yield on your holdings. This process is often facilitated by platforms that offer user-friendly interfaces, abstracting away much of the technical complexity. The beauty of staking lies in its passive nature; once your assets are staked, they can generate returns with minimal ongoing effort, allowing your digital wealth to grow while you focus on other pursuits.

Another significant avenue within the Crypto Earnings System is yield farming, a more advanced strategy within Decentralized Finance (DeFi). DeFi aims to recreate traditional financial services – lending, borrowing, trading – without intermediaries, using smart contracts on blockchains. In yield farming, users provide liquidity to decentralized exchanges or lending protocols. This liquidity is crucial for the smooth functioning of these platforms. In exchange for their assets, users receive rewards, often in the form of the platform's native token, which can then be further staked or traded. Yield farming can offer significantly higher returns than staking, but it also comes with greater risks, including impermanent loss (a risk associated with providing liquidity to automated market makers) and smart contract vulnerabilities. Navigating yield farming requires a deeper understanding of DeFi protocols and diligent risk management.

Beyond these, the Crypto Earnings System encompasses mining. This is the process by which new units of certain cryptocurrencies, particularly those using a Proof-of-Work consensus mechanism like Bitcoin, are created. Miners use specialized hardware to solve complex computational problems, validating transactions and adding them to the blockchain. As a reward for their computational power and energy expenditure, they receive newly minted coins and transaction fees. While mining has become increasingly institutionalized due to the high cost of hardware and electricity, it still represents a foundational element of the Crypto Earnings System, directly contributing to the security and integrity of the network.

One of the most accessible and widely adopted methods within the Crypto Earnings System is staking. In essence, staking involves locking up a certain amount of cryptocurrency to help secure and operate a blockchain network. Blockchains that use a Proof-of-Stake (PoS) consensus mechanism, rather than Proof-of-Work (PoW) like Bitcoin, rely on stakers to validate transactions and create new blocks. In return for their commitment, stakers receive rewards, typically in the form of additional cryptocurrency. This is akin to earning interest on a savings account, but with the potential for higher yields. The return rates can vary significantly depending on the cryptocurrency, the network’s activity, and the specific staking period. Platforms often offer user-friendly interfaces to manage staking, abstracting away much of the technical complexity, making it an attractive option for those seeking passive income with relatively lower risk compared to active trading. However, it's important to understand that staked assets are often locked for a period, meaning they cannot be accessed or traded during that time, and the value of the staked cryptocurrency can fluctuate.

Closely related to staking, but often more complex and potentially more lucrative, is lending. In the decentralized finance (DeFi) space, users can lend their cryptocurrencies to borrowers through smart contracts on various lending platforms. These platforms act as intermediaries, connecting lenders and borrowers without the need for traditional banks. Borrowers typically provide collateral, mitigating the risk for lenders. Lenders earn interest on the assets they deposit, with rates determined by supply and demand dynamics. Some platforms offer variable rates, while others allow users to fix their rates for a set period. The risk here lies in the smart contract’s security and the potential for the collateral to devalue, leading to defaults. Thorough research into the reputation and security audits of lending platforms is paramount for any prospective lender.

Yield farming, a cornerstone of DeFi, represents a more aggressive strategy for generating returns. It involves deploying capital across various DeFi protocols to maximize returns, often through a combination of lending, providing liquidity to decentralized exchanges (DEXs), and staking LP (liquidity provider) tokens. Yield farmers actively seek out the highest yields, often moving their funds between different platforms and strategies to chase the best APYs (Annual Percentage Yields). While the potential returns can be exceptionally high, the risks are also substantial. Impermanent loss, where the value of your deposited assets in a liquidity pool diverges from simply holding them, is a significant concern. Additionally, the complexity of smart contracts, the possibility of hacks, and the rapid evolution of yield farming strategies require a deep understanding and constant vigilance. It's a strategy best suited for those with a high risk tolerance and a dedicated approach to managing their digital assets.

Automated Market Makers (AMMs), the engines behind many DEXs, offer another avenue for earning. By providing liquidity to an AMM pool, you enable others to trade that specific pair of tokens. In return for facilitating these trades, you earn a portion of the trading fees generated by the pool. This is intrinsically linked to yield farming, as the LP tokens you receive for providing liquidity can often be staked elsewhere for additional rewards. The returns are generally tied to the trading volume of the token pair. Higher volume means more fees. However, the risk of impermanent loss is a constant factor, as the value of the two tokens in the pool can drift apart. Understanding the volatility of the token pair is crucial before committing capital to an AMM pool.

Finally, while not always directly accessible to individuals without significant capital, masternodes represent another layer of earning potential within the Crypto Earnings System. Masternodes are special servers that support a blockchain network by performing specific functions, such as instant transactions, enhanced privacy features, or participating in governance. Running a masternode typically requires holding a substantial amount of the cryptocurrency as collateral, along with the technical expertise to maintain the server. In return for their service and investment, masternode operators receive rewards, often in the form of a share of the block rewards. This is a more institutional-level earning strategy that offers consistent returns for those who can meet the demanding requirements.

The Mechanics Behind Content Token Royalties

Imagine a painter whose digital artwork is bought by a collector. Thanks to content token royalties, every time that artwork changes hands, a portion of the transaction is automatically allocated back to the original creator. This isn’t a one-time payment but an ongoing revenue stream, ensuring that creators continue to benefit from their work long after the initial sale.

This mechanism is powered by smart contracts—self-executing contracts with the terms of the agreement directly written into code. When a tokenized piece of content is sold, the smart contract activates, calculating the royalty fee and sending it to the creator’s wallet. This process is seamless, transparent, and impervious to fraud, as all transactions are recorded on the blockchain.

Challenges and Considerations

While the surge in content token royalties presents numerous opportunities, it also comes with challenges and considerations that need to be addressed to ensure the model's success and sustainability:

1. Regulatory Compliance: As content token royalties gain popularity, regulatory frameworks need to evolve to address issues like taxation, intellectual property rights, and consumer protection. Ensuring that the model complies with legal and regulatory standards is crucial for its long-term viability.

2. Scalability: The scalability of blockchain networks is a critical factor. As the number of transactions involving tokenized content increases, the blockchain network must handle this volume efficiently to avoid congestion and high transaction fees. Advances in blockchain technology, such as layer-2 solutions and sharding, are essential to address scalability issues.

3. Environmental Impact: The environmental impact of blockchain technology, particularly proof-of-work (PoW) consensus mechanisms, has been a point of concern. Transitioning to more sustainable consensus mechanisms like proof-of-stake (PoS) can help mitigate the environmental footprint of blockchain networks.

4. User Adoption and Education: For content token royalties to thrive, widespread adoption and understanding among creators and consumers are necessary. Educational initiatives and user-friendly platforms can help bridge the knowledge gap and encourage more people to participate in this new economic model.
